Output 59ddbece6ef5d5bab87eef90415b7b23717a0ad2ea62ada88a12ca3c1e652a8e:0

value
1578944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 078bf4250d162f33874fc6e21d0dc76cacca0281 OP_EQUAL
address
32NvK3ExXefADPWhbMHXUb5CUNzHPNP842
transaction
59ddbece6ef5d5bab87eef90415b7b23717a0ad2ea62ada88a12ca3c1e652a8e
confirmations
336601
spent
true